"It is time. It's time that a woman can make a living with a rope." -Hope Thompson


This is one episode you don't want to miss. WPRA World Champion, NFBR Qualifier, CNFR Champion, and All-Around roping legend, Hope Thompson talks about how she got involved in the sport of rodeo, her journey as a competitor and a female through the roping world, and gives some absolutely killer advice to the next generation. She shares all of this after winning nearly $60,000 at the Women's Rodeo World Championship (WRWC) in Fort Worth, Texas, on May 16-18.


Hope is real, honest, and everything you could love to root for in a champion.
